Everything you need to know about National Security Adviser Michael Flynn

Tuesday, November 29, 2016
Retired Lt. Gen. Michael Thomas Flynn has been selected by President-elect Donald Trump to serve as National Security Adviser.

Flynn is a 33-year Army veteran who served as Director of the Defense Intelligence Agency during the Obama administration from 2012-2014. He was fired from his position and has since become a critic of President Obama's foreign policy.

According to ABC News, he worked as an informal political adviser on national security issues for Trump's presidential campaign.
